
No, not every car can be recharged. The common lead-acid battery found in most gasoline-powered vehicles is designed to be recharged by the car's alternator and is the type you can safely recharge at home. However, attempting to recharge a non-rechargeable or disposable battery, or using the wrong charger on a modern battery type, can be dangerous and cause damage.
The key is identifying the battery type. Standard flooded lead-acid and its modern counterparts, Absorbent Glass Mat (AGM) and Enhanced Flooded Battery (EFB), are all rechargeable. These are the batteries you'll find under the hood of most cars and trucks. The charging process must be done correctly. Using a smart battery charger that automatically adjusts the voltage and amperage is crucial to prevent overcharging, which can damage the battery and release hazardous gases.
In contrast, some batteries are not meant to be recharged. For instance, if you have a small, disposable battery for a car key fob or an older, dry-cell battery, attempting to recharge it could lead to leakage, overheating, or even rupture. Another critical point involves Electric Vehicle (EV) batteries. While they are rechargeable, they use complex high-voltage lithium-ion packs. These require specialized charging equipment and should only be serviced by qualified technicians.
Ultimately, if your car's main battery is dead, it's likely rechargeable. But safety is paramount. Always check the battery label for specifications and use a compatible charger.
| Battery Type | Rechargeable? | Common Use | Key Consideration |
|---|---|---|---|
| Flooded Lead-Acid | Yes | Most gasoline cars | Requires ventilation; check water levels |
| AGM (Absorbent Glass Mat) | Yes | Start-Stop systems, premium cars | Handles higher charge rates; needs a compatible charger |
| EFB (Enhanced Flooded) | Yes | Basic Start-Stop systems | Improved cycle life over standard lead-acid |
| Lithium-Ion (EV) | Yes | Electric Vehicles | Requires proprietary, high-voltage charging station |
| Alkaline (Disposable) | No | Key fobs, small devices | Attempting to recharge is dangerous |

It depends entirely on the chemistry. Standard automotive lead-acid batteries are designed for repeated charging cycles. However, confusing them with disposable consumer batteries is a serious safety hazard. Recharging a non-rechargeable battery can cause thermal runaway—a rapid, uncontrolled temperature increase leading to fire or explosion. Always check the manufacturer's label for a "rechargeable" designation before proceeding.
